Just bought my first Ruger Bearcat. It is stainless, with a manufacture date of March 2013. I've read they have always come with aluminum ejector housings, but mine is stainless. I know there is a Lipsey's special run with short barrel, birds head grip, and stainless ejector housing, but mine is the standard model with square butt and four inch barrel. Bought it new on Gunbroker out of Georgia. I might be suspicious that someone had put an aftermarket steel ejector housing on it, but it is clearly brand new, test-fired at the factory on March 25. Yesterday I saw a stainless Bearcat at Cabela's and it had the aluminum ejector housing. So I wonder if Ruger is transitioning away from the criticized aluminum ejector housing for new Bearcats. Or, did I just get an anomaly?
